In the Omelnyk direction, Russian forces continued their assault operations, making new progress in two different areas.
In the northeast, Russian forces continued to advance south of Hulyaipole, where they captured new positions in the treelines and forest northwest of Dorozhnyanka.
In the southwest, after entering Bilohirya from the south and east, the Russians established control over most of the village, and began attacks to the north in the direction of the Ukrainian positions on the tactical heights.
+ ~3.78 kmยฒ in favour of Russia.

In the Pokrovs'ke direction, Ukrainian forces have consolidated numerous treelines east of the Haichur River following failed Russian operations.
Over the last month, Ukrainian forces have been incrementally regaining solid control over positions east of the Haichur River. These operations have been conducted in areas where Russian forces did not properly entrench in and only moved through to their forward positions west of the river.
Due to this lack of Russian consolidation, the Ukrainians were able to regain control over the village of Radisne which had previously been in a sort of zone of Russian influence with no permanent presence, and managed to link up with isolated pockets of soldiers in the treelines further east. As a result, a large grey-zone has formed stretching up to 4.5 km wide in some areas, where both sides have overlapping positions in an extremely fluid and dynamic situation.
The establishment of solid positions east of the river by Ukraine has allowed them to increase their overall presence in this grey-zone of mixed positions in recent weeks, significantly complicating Russian logistics to their own bridgeheads west of the Haichur river. Nevertheless, Russian forces continued their operations west of the river, with DRGs still infiltrating the village of Kosivtseve, and for the first time, entering the town of Ternuvate.
+ ~13.70 kmยฒ in favour of Ukraine.

In the Novopavlivka direction, both Russian and Ukrainian forces have advanced, each capturing positions in the village of Novopidhorodne.
At some point recently, Ukrainian forces launched counterattacks in northeastern Novopidhorodne, recapturing positions along two residential streets, shrinking the Russian incursion zone.
Since then, the Russians have resumed their attacks through the southern part of the village, capturing new positions along Shevchenka Street. Additionally, under heavy artillery cover, assault operations are being carried out on the central part of the village, as well as along the railway line to the south. DRGs have also penetrated the western streets.
+ ~0.66 kmยฒ in favour of Ukraine.
+ ~0.09 kmยฒ in favour of Russia.

In the Dobropillya direction, Russian forces resumed their assault operations north of Pokrovsk and recaptured previously lost positions there.
Russian forces advanced northwest from the forested areas northwest of Myrnohrad, recapturing the highway intersection. Other forces attacked up the treelines on a wide front north of Pokrovsk, re-establishing control over a large section of the road to Hryshyne and one of the pig farms.
+ ~6.04 kmยฒ in favour of Russia.

In the Svyatohirsk direction, Russian forces continued to advance and have captured new positions in three different areas.
In the southeast, Russian forces resumed their assault operations towards eastern Yarova, recapturing positions in the forests there and reaching the edge of the town.
To the west, the Russians advanced south to the western part of Yarova, recapturing positions in the forests south of the railway line. They also began attacks to the southwest and west, improving their positions in the forests and reaching the outskirts of Sosnove.
To the north, Russian forces resumed their assault operations in the direction of Oleksandrivka, where they advanced northwest and captured new positions in the forests there.
+ ~4.26 kmยฒ in favour of Russia.

In the Lyman direction, Russian forces continued their assault operations and have made new progress northeast of Lyman.
In the northeast, Russian forces resumed their assault operations northwest of Zarichne and captured new treeline positions north of the gulley. From there, they began attacking the Ukrainian positions east of Stavky. Other assault groups are attempting to attack these same positions via the treelines from the eastern part of Stavky. assault operations are also underway on the agricultural buildings on the western outskirts of Stavky.
In the southwest, Russian forces continued incrementally consolidating in the fields west of the Pynkov Yar Gulley, where they were able to capture new treeline positions in the direction of the first cluster of agricultural buildings. DRGs continue to infiltrate further west to the northern outskirts of Lyman.
+ ~1.11 kmยฒ in favour of Russia.

In the Lyman direction, both Russian and Ukrainian forces have advanced southeast of Lyman in the area of the Siverskyi Donets River.
In the southeast, Russian forces continued to slowly advance in and around Ozerne. They managed to capture the remaining positions in the northwestern houses and captured the last Ukrainian strongpoint in the forest to the north, allowing for them to establish control over almost all of the northern part of the village.
To the northwest, Russian forces improved their positions in the forests east of Dibrova, largely levelling the frontline in the direction of the Siverskyi Donets River.
To the west, Ukrainian forces launched a counterattack, recapturing the southern and southwestern streets of Dibrova and re-entering the central part of the village.
In the northwest, Russian forces continued advancing west through the forests northwest of Dibrova, capturing new positions in the direction of the Lyman - Raihorodok Road.
+ ~1.97 kmยฒ in favour of Russia.
+ ~1.16 kmยฒ in favour of Ukraine.
